the CSL style "Deutsche Sprache" https://www.zotero.org/styles/deutsche-sprache seems to be the best fit for my bachelor thesis, but I would need authors' names to be initialized at the bottom page references.
I.e. Battmer, Rolf-Dieter (%Year of publication%) -> Battmer, R.-D. (%Year of publication%)
I tried playing around with initialize-with, but I didn't manage the correct syntax.
Also I would like to leave out S. (short for Seite - German: page) in the main text, i.e. "%Author's name% %Year of Publication%, S. %Page number%" -> "%Author's name% %Year of Publication%, %Page number%"

Could you tell me what to copy -> paste into the original csl file?

  • 1) Add initialize-with="." into the <name> element on line 30 of the style.

    2) Delete the line <text term="page" form="symbol"/> in the <citation> section of the style (lines 115 and 127).
